On Jan 3, 2008 2:49 PM, Felix Knecht <felixk@apache.org> wrote:
Just unzipped all the eclipse stuff in the {mysandox}/tools and run the
last command from tools/shell-commands.txt.

But please don't even if it sounds easy - I had to do some weird
patching  in the maven-eclipse-plugin to get it working because of
http://www.nabble.com/OverConstrainedVersionException-td14289478s177.html
(don't know if this is a bug in maven itself or in the
maven-eclipse-plugin ...)

I have 3 new dependencies to add. They are not packaged as jar or zip files but as simple folders.
How should I do ?

I tried what you explained above but I got a failure:
[INFO] Scanning for projects...
[INFO] Searching repository for plugin with prefix: 'eclipse'.
[INFO] ------------------------------------------------------------------------
[ERROR] BUILD FAILURE
[INFO] ------------------------------------------------------------------------
[INFO] Required goal not found: eclipse:to-maven
[INFO] ------------------------------------------------------------------------
[INFO] For more information, run Maven with the -e switch
[INFO] ------------------------------------------------------------------------
[INFO] Total time: < 1 second
[INFO] Finished at: Thu Jan 03 16:43:02 CET 2008
[INFO] Final Memory: 1M/3M
[INFO] ------------------------------------------------------------------------

 
Yes. you can do like this and sha/md5 are generate (see also
http://maven.apache.org/plugins/maven-deploy-plugin/usage.html at the
bottom):

felix@lapfelix ~/svn/apache/directory/maven-studio/tools $ touch sample.jar
felix@lapfelix ~/svn/apache/directory/maven-studio/tools $ mvn
deploy:deploy-file -Durl=file:../local-repository -Dfile=sample.jar
-Dpackaging=jar -DgroupId=myGroup -DartifactId=sample -Dversion=1.0.0
-DgeneratePom=true
[INFO] Scanning for projects...
[INFO] Searching repository for plugin with prefix: 'deploy'.
[INFO]
------------------------------------------------------------------------
[INFO] Building Maven Default Project
[INFO]    task-segment: [deploy:deploy-file] (aggregator-style)
[INFO]
------------------------------------------------------------------------
[INFO] [deploy:deploy-file]
Uploading: file:../local-repository/myGroup/sample/1.0.0/sample-1.0.0.jar
0b uploaded
[INFO] Retrieving previous metadata from remote-repository
[INFO] Uploading repository metadata for: 'artifact myGroup:sample'
[INFO] Retrieving previous metadata from remote-repository
[INFO] Uploading project information for sample 1.0.0
[INFO]
------------------------------------------------------------------------
[INFO] BUILD SUCCESSFUL
[INFO]
------------------------------------------------------------------------
[INFO] Total time: 1 second
[INFO] Finished at: Thu Jan 03 14:40:11 CET 2008
[INFO] Final Memory: 2M/5M

Thanks for the hint. It worked well.

Pierre-Arnaud